Runbook: font vendoring for the Typeshed pipeline. Support, if a customer reports a missing or wrong glyph, do not hotlink a font — everything must go through the vendored bundle. Open a ticket with the family name and weight; the build team re-vendors, re-hashes, and ships within one cycle. Never edit font files in place; the verifier will reject the bundle. The vendoring job runs with the configuration below.

settings of tagef-bawif:
DRUIX_HOST=druix.zemvarlabs.internal
DRUIX_PORT=8000

Ticket: Intermittent connection failures on Renderhive transcode farm

Nodes in the Veldmont rack are dropping their job-queue database connections roughly every 40 minutes, causing stalled transcodes and retry storms. Suspect the pooler restart loop introduced in last week's patch. On-call: restart the pooler on the affected nodes and verify connectivity manually. For the manual check, use the connection string shown directly below.

replica DSN, kajep-yahag: mssql://praok_svc:iF@db-8d68.plorvaio.local:5432/eliion

Capacity note — Vellumgate queue-depth autoscaler. The scaler samples broker queue depth every tick and compares against a rolling p95 baseline; scale-up decisions fire only after two consecutive breaches to avoid flapping during Lunavore's batch ingest windows. Scale-down is deliberately slower (one step per cooldown period) because cold workers take nearly a minute to warm the Pexfield codec pool. Please do not change one constant in isolation — they interact. The current tuning constants are as follows.

constants for tafog-kahag:
RATE_LIMITS = {
    "sorir": 697,
    "oliox": 683,
    "holax": 176,
    "casox": 60,
    "pelius": 382,
}